Job Summary
This position will provide daily support to the Office Management & Fleet Supervisor while assisting visitors and departments located in Pinellas County offices of Family Support Services. Responsibilities include, but are not limited to: greeting guests, scheduling conference rooms, processing monthly finance documentation, answering phones, assisting with coordination of vehicle maintenance, providing customer service, submitting requests for building maintenance, ordering/stocking office supplies, and handling mail. The position will take on additional office management duties as directed by the Office Management & Fleet Supervisor, Business Office Manager and/or V.P. of Human Resources
Job Duties
- Serves as administrative support for the Office Management & Fleet Supervisor and assists visitors/clients at the FSS offices in Largo
- Provides outstanding customer service to clients, partner agencies and team members. This includes assisting in-office visitors, and ensuring deliveries/mail/calls are properly routed
- Assists in routine fleet management documentation & coordination of maintenance as directed by Supervisor
- Completes duties related to office management such as ordering/stocking office supplies, maintaining staff contact lists, scheduling conference rooms, requesting building maintenance, and supporting administrative functions.
- Assists in administrative projects relating to various needs of the agency; also completes assignments as directed by the Business Office Manager or V.P. of Human Resources.
- Submits pertinent documents to the finance department on a routine basis.
- Perform other duties as assigned
